Member Matchmaking Tool
The Upside needed a better way to match members together at scale. At first, the founder was personally matchmaking people based on her intuition and knowledge of their profiles. Then, they moved to unwieldy spreadsheets as the membership grew. Finally, they tried a matching tool with an expensive annual subscription which didn't fit their ideal process. We created a community-facing tool with an admin backend to create and manage matching 'rounds'. Members can answer a few questions to get matched up based on their similarity and automatically get connected for one-on-one conversations. This new tool saved thousands per year in subscription costs and had high member engagement, which leads directly to higher member retention.

Knowledgebase App 'Q'
We built this platform for G2 Venture Partners on Bubble.io a few years ago. We custom code most projects now, but this app still functions well on Bubble. This app pulls together many disparate systems they were using without becoming a 'source of truth'. They're able to still use the tools they're used to for data management, while using Q as a way to get to information quickly, as well as quickly enter new deals into their systems. After using it for a while, they nicknamed it 'Q' after the all-knowing Star Trek character.
